Men's tennis heads to Malibu for opening rounds of 2006 NCAA Tournament

Frogs to take on San Diego

May 12, 2006


FORT WORTH, Texas - The 32nd-ranked TCU men's tennis team will begin its 2006 NCAA Tournament run on Saturday at 2 p.m. (CST) when it takes on 38th-ranked San Diego in Malibu, Calif.

The Frogs come into Saturday's match after posting three-straight victories to claim the Mountain West Conference Tournament Championship. With the win and the women claiming the title on their end, TCU became only the third institution to claim both titles in the same year (BYU 2001, San Diego State 2003).

Sophomore Andrei Mlendea highlights a TCU roster that boasts two ranked singles teams and a doubles squad. Mlendea is currently ranked 34th in the ITA singles poll after posting 15-7 record. The Oradea, Romania, product recorded back-to-back victories versus Top 10 opponents in fourth-ranked Lars Poerschke of Baylor and eighth-ranked Jerry Makowski of Texas A&M.

Senior Rafael Abreu holds the No. 91 position in the singles poll and is ranked 27th in doubles action alongside Jordan Freitas.

TCU leads San Diego 4-0 in the all-time series that dates back to 1982. In the last meeting, the Frogs prevailed by a score of 4-1 at the Friedman Tennis Center Indoor Courts on Feb. 19.
